Florida Remembers Slain Journalist Steven Sotloff
Flags throughout the state will fly at half-staff Friday.

Gov. Rick Scott has called for all flags on federal and state building grounds in Florida to fly at half-staff Friday in honor of journalist Steven Sotloff.
Sotloffβs beheading was depicted in a video released by the terrorist group ISIS earlier this week.
βThe people who did this are evil,β Scott said in a statement released following news of Sotloffβs death. βThey are not merely wrong, they are not adversaries, they are evil. And evil must be confronted and destroyed.β

Sotloff, 31, worked as a freelancer for such publications as Time and Christian Science Monitor during his career. He was raised in Miami and attended the University of Central Florida.
UCF staged a vigil in Sotloffβs honor earlier this week that was attended by hundreds, according to Bay News 9.

In Tuesdayβs video, Sotloff, dressed in a prison-type orange jumpsuit, said he was βpaying the priceβ for Americaβs intervention in the Middle East, moments prior to beheading.
The ISIS representative is believed to be former British rapper Abdel-Majed Abdel Bary, 24, according to AOL. He is also believed to be the same man who appeared in an August video showing the death of journalist James Foley.
βIβm back, Obama, and Iβm back because of your arrogant foreign policy towards the Islamic State,β the man says on the video. He went on to say that Americaβs βinsistence on continuing your bombings on Mosul Damβ are to blame.
Scott offered his condolences to the Sotloff family and called out President Barack Obamaβs lack of a strategy for dealing with ISIS in his statement on the killing.
βHere is what they need to understand β Steve Sotloff was a Floridian, but more importantly he was an American,β Scott said. βIf you attack one American, you are attacking all Americans. Last week President Obama said that his Administration does not at present have a strategy for dealing with ISIS β these immoral evil people.
βI think I can speak for all Floridians and all Americans when I say that the time for a strategy is now, and part of that strategy needs to include destroying them.β
